Homemade Beefy Melt Burritos

Description

Delicious burritos with seasoned beef, molten cheese, and bright accompaniments, all wrapped in a crisp tortilla.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b (450 g) lean ground beef (80/20 recommended)
  • 1 small yellow onion, finely di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1/2 cup beef stock or low-sodium broth
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ar
  • 1 cup shredded Monterey Jack
  • 4 large flour tortillas (10–12-inch)
  • 1 tbsp butter, softened
  • Pickled jalapeños or quick-pickled red onions, fined sliced
  • Fresh cilantro, chopped
  • Lime wedges
  • Sour cream or crema

Instructions

  1. Prepare ingredients: grate cheeses, warm tortillas, and have toppings ready.
  2.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ering.
  3. Brown the beef by adding oil and the ground beef. Press and let it sear undisturbed for 3–4 minutes.
  4. Push beef to the side, add onion, and sauté for 3–4 minutes until soft; add garlic and cook for 30–45 seconds.
  5. Stir in tomato paste, cumin, and chili powder; toast briefly. Deglaze with warm beef stock.
  6. Simmer until liquid reduces and clings to the meat. Season to taste.
  7. Assemble: lay a tortilla flat, spoon 1/4 of the beef mixture down the center, and top with cheese and toppings.
  8. Fold and seal the burrito tightly. Brush with softened butter.
  9. Crisp in a skillet over medium heat for 2–3 minutes per side until golden and cheese melts.
  10. Transfer to a cutting board, let rest for 2 minutes, then slice and serve with lime wedges and crema.

Notes

To prevent sogginess, reduce the meat sauce until it clings to the beef. Brown in batches for deep caramelization.
